Pasta pomodoro in 4 easy steps. cook your pasta. add a generous amount of salt to a large pot of water and cook your pasta until al dente. make the sauce. add olive oil to a large skillet and cook your garlic for about 10 15 seconds, being careful not to burn it. stir in the cherry tomatoes, season with salt and pepper, and gently smash them. Instructions. place the minced onion, garlic, celery, carrots, whole canned tomatoes, basil, olive oil and 2 teaspoons kosher salt in a large saucepan. simmer for 45 minutes with a lid ajar, stirring occasionally. remove from the heat and rest 5 minutes. discard the basil leaves.
